> Extract pushable predicates from disjunctive predicates

> Example:
> {code:sql}
> select count(*)
> from
>   db.very_large_table
> where
>   session_start_dt between date_sub('2023-07-15', 1) and date_add('2023-07-16', 1)
>   and type = 'event'
>   and date(event_timestamp) between '2023-07-15' and '2023-07-16'
>   and (
>     (
>       page_id in (2627, 2835, 2402999)
>       and -- other predicates
>       and rdt = 0
>     ) or (
>       page_id in (2616, 3411350)
>       and rdt = 0
>     ) or (
>       page_id = 2403006
>     ) or (
>       page_id in (2208336, 2356359)
>       and -- other predicates
>       and rdt = 0
>     )
>   )
> {code}
> We can push down {{page_id in(2627, 2835, 2402999, 2616, 3411350, 2403006, 2208336, 2356359)}} to datasource.
